I've used a couple of carriers in the past.  Both of them used enclosed trailers and called to let you know the progress.  However, they required the vehicle to run under it's own power.  Since many of these carry several vehicles, there is no guarantee that your car will be in the same spot unless you can buy the entire load.  It may be more expensive, but you can contract a flatbed to go and pick up the Camaro.

The last time I used Reliable (a national carrier), they were around $800 per vehicle from Texas to Florida.  This was about 7 years ago for a Viper.  A friend of mine had a '35 Ford brought down to NC a couple of years ago from Indiana on a flatbed for $400.  I have found the rates vary quite a bit.
